Device programming (Pairing)
To use Bluetooth
®
Hands-Free, the device
equipped with Bluetooth
®
has to be
programmed to the hands-free unit using
the following procedure.
A maximum of seven devices including
hands-free mobile phones and Bluetooth
®
audio devices can be programmed to one
vehicle.
NOTE
l
A device can be programmed only when the
vehicle is parked. If the vehicle starts to
move, the pairing procedure will end.
Programming is dangerous while driving -
pair up your device before you start
driving. Park the car in a safe place before
programming.
l
If a Bluetooth
®
device has already been
programmed to the vehicle as a Bluetooth
®
audio device, it does not need to be
programmed again when using the device
as a hands-free mobile phone. Conversely,
it does not need to be programmed again as
a Bluetooth
®
audio device if it has already
been programmed as a hands-free mobile
phone.
l
Since the communication range of a
Bluetooth
®
equipped device is about 10
meters (32 ft), if a device is placed within a
10-meter (32 ft) radius of the vehicle, it may
be detected/programmed unintentionally
while another device is being programmed.
1. Activate the Blueto oth
®
application of
the device.
NOTE
For the operation of the device, refer to its
instruction manual.
2. Press the pick-up button or talk button
with a short press.
3. Say: [Beep] Setup
4. Prompt: Select one of the following:
Pairing options, confirmation prompts,
language, passcode, select phone or
select music player.
5. Say: [Beep] Pairing options
6. Prompt: Select one of the following:
Pair, Edit, Delete, List, or Set Pairing
Code.
7. Say: [Beep] Pair
8. Prompt: Start the pairing process on
your Bluetooth
®
device. Your pairing
code is 0000 (XXXX). Input this code
on your Bluetooth
®
device when
prompted on the device. See device
manual for instructions.
9. Using the device, perform a search for
the Bluetooth
®
device (Peripheral
device).
NOTE
For the operation of the device, refer to its
instruction manual.
10. Select Mazda from the device list
searched by the device.
11. Input the 4-digit pairing c ode to the
device.
12. Prompt: Please say the name of the
device after the beep.
13. Say: [Beep] XXXX - - - (Speak a
device tag, an arbitrary name for
the device.)
Example: Stan's device.
NOTE
Speak a programmed device tag within 10
seconds.
If more than two devices are to be
programmed, they cannot be programmed with
the same or similar device tag.
